ID:81331 

S. M. from Westcliff On Sea

Friday 6 October 2023 (1 year ago)

Area:Middle Wye

Beat:Caradoc

Fishing:Coarse

No. of Anglers:4

Only one rod fished as unfortunately my partner was unable to make the trip....River here was a touch higher than anticipated with the beach area underwater and very pacey...I managed to find some fish though on feeder and float with the highlight being 2 nice Grayling!! Has been 2 or 3 years since I last caught one so a delightful surprise....Best Barbel was about 8lbs and it was pleasing to fish here without being disturbed with kayaks/swimmers etc so a really good day.

4 Barbel, 4 Chub, 10 Other

ID:81178 

A. G. from Harleston norfolk

Thursday 5 October 2023 (1 year ago)

Area:Tees

Beat:Darlington Brown Trout AA North Bank - River Tees

Fishing:Winter Grayling

No. of Anglers:1

Disappointing results on what looked like a nice piece of water. The problem was, there are few obvious looking spots, the river is very big ( 60 to 80 yards wide ) but it is all 1 to 3 feet deep all over. The bed is all made up of football sized rocks so the surface is all bumpy and fast flowing. I don't recomend parking at bottom of beat because you have a 1/2 mile difficult walk to get to any fish able water ! The fish I did catch were also very small.

2 Trout, 2 Grayling
